Hello Goofy,

Never heard this wrong informations in my life. Where are they coming from?

The cs2 software is existing as Mac OS and Windows version. To update the cs2 you do not need neither mac OS nor Windows. Just connect the cs2 directly to the net or download the update on a stick with a pc with an operating system of your choice and connect the stick to the cs2.
The cs2 itself is running with a Linux operating system and is reachable trough a browser access to upload for example the locomotive icons. It doesn't matter under which operating system the browser is running.

So where is the only windows support of the CSx? I guess for the cs3 it will be the same
